Biological Parasite Control Techniques
Natural bug control methods have gotten prestige as property owners look for more secure and more sustainable choices to traditional chemical methods. Organic bug control strategies utilize natural predators, bloodsuckers, or virus to manage pest populations successfully. This approach is not just eco-friendly but likewise minimizes the danger of damage to non-target types, consisting of valuable insects and wildlife.
One of the most common biological control techniques includes presenting all-natural predators into the atmosphere. Ladybugs can be made use of to regulate aphid populaces, while nematodes target soil-dwelling bugs like grubs. In addition, parasitoids-- microorganisms that reside on or within a host-- can be utilized to manage certain bug types by laying eggs inside them, eventually resulting in their demise.
Another approach is the use of biopesticides, which are originated from all-natural products such as microorganisms, minerals, or plants (bed bug exterminator). These items can successfully target pests while positioning very little risk to pets and human beings. Generally, biological pest control strategies supply property owners with an efficient methods of pest monitoring that lines up with ecological concepts, promoting a much healthier living atmosphere while decreasing dependence on synthetic chemicals

Integrated Pest Monitoring Approaches
Integrated Bug Administration (IPM) represents an all natural technique that integrates various strategies to successfully handle pest populaces while lessening environmental influence. This method integrates organic, cultural, physical, and chemical practices to attain sustainable pest control. By assessing pest populaces and their natural adversaries, IPM highlights surveillance and determining pests prior to executing control actions.
One of the core concepts of IPM is using thresholds, which establish the degree of pest task that warrants treatment. This ensures that therapies are applied only when essential, minimizing the dependence on chemical pesticides. Biological control techniques, such as introducing natural predators or parasites, job in combination with cultural techniques like crop turning and habitat control to interfere with pest life cycles.
In addition, IPM encourages the usage of least-toxic chemical options when intervention is essential, prioritizing products that try this present very little risk to non-target organisms and the atmosphere. For homeowners, embracing IPM comes close to not just enhances the efficacy of bug monitoring but likewise advertises a much healthier living environment, promoting biodiversity and lowering chemical exposure. Ultimately, IPM equips house owners to make enlightened decisions that balance insect control with environmental duty.
